Washing, Checking, Up-Keeping and Exchanging (Washing)

1.

Washing

Notice: check the metal rag around the magnet first before washing, large granule or irregular metal

granule shows the disintegratation or similar damage. Small or fine metal granule shows the uneven

or serious wear. If the metal rag is founded, notice shall be taken on damage and wear inspection

during checking the rotating parts and the element matched with the rotating parts.

(a)

Common washing

Wash the parts in cleaning agent to clean away the old lubricant and deposit. Clean away the deposit in oil hole

with brush. Take notice not to scrape the metal coupling face when washing the parts cannot be cleaned with

brush.

(b)

Dry the washed parts by blowing

Dry the washed parts by blowing the low-pressure compressed air (max pressure is 137.9kPa), because cloth

thread may be left during cleaning the parts with cloth. The bearing shall be held by hand to prevent it from

rotating when blowing it.

(c)

Bearing lubrication

The ball bearing and needle bearing shall be lubricated with the lubricant for transfer box after washing. As

the non-lubricated bearing may cause damage when be dry. Cover the lubricated bearing to prevent dust

entering in.

Checking

1.

Common Checking process

Check all parts by visual check to see whether there is damage

or serious or uneven wear (parts needed be substituted by new

parts such as O-ring, oil seal and etc. shall be excluded).

Abandon the damaged or weary parts that will affect on their

performance. The check items are as follows:
Burr: tips protruded from the material regionally
Rag: broken small blocks or particles
Crack: surface thread showing the material is partly or

completely separated.

Excessive abrasionRefer to the serious or obvious abra-

sion beyond of application limit.

Reduction changeMaterial slip caused by the heavy

pressure on part of it.

adhesive bondingGranules of the soft metal are dis-

persed and bonded on the hard metal surface.

Ditch trance: partial crack or trough that means the material

transfer instead of material loss.

Pitting corrosionDamages to the metal surface caused by

pressure, which are displayed due to color change caused

by heat generated by metal friction.

Step weara weary step may be seen or felled between the

neighboring interface or between the non-touching face

due to the excessive wear.

Uneven wear: Partially, unevenly distributed wear, which

includes holes, bright spots, uneven polishing or other

visual drawbacks.

4.

Key tooth inspection

Check the broken or peeled spline teeth. The spline teeth may,

if only small part is peeled off, be repaired in the same way as

that for the gear teeth, and can be reused. In case the spline

tooth is broken, the spline must be abandoned. The contact

type of spline is not the same as that for gear; however, spline

that shows step sliding must be abandoned.

Maintenance or Change of Gear or Chain

Sprocket Gear

1.

Maintenance principle

(a) Conduct the maintenance for the partial, small peel off

with the suitable instruction high-speed grinding tool.

(b) Do not clear away the metal as can as possible when

grinding the matrix metal.

(c) All pointed angles and sides must be repaired as the slip-

pery contour line. Because the pointed angle or edges

may be peeled off again or developed into crack.

(d) Clear away the burr with the suitable grinding stone. Take

notice not to damage the matrix when clearing away the

projecting materials, and

(e) When substituting the non-repaired parts (such as

bearing), if the part is doubted in its re-application

capability, it must be changed.
